B33 0AW is a residential postcode in Tile Cross, Birmingham. It was first introduced in December 1995.
The most common council tax band is A.
Residential buildings are typically detached, semi-detached and terraced (including end-terrace). Domestic properties are primarily flats.
Residential buildings were typically constructed between 1991 and 1995 and between 1996 and 2002.
Domestic properties are predominantly social housing.
The most common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) ratings are C and D.
Birmingham is a city, which had a population of 1,085,810 in the 2011 census.
In the 2011 census, there were 15 people resident in B33 0AW, of which 8 were male and 7 were female. This includes overnight visitors as well as permanent residents.
B33 0AW is in the Birmingham travel to work area. NHS services are provided by the Birmingham East and North Primary Care Trust.
B33 0AW is approximately 94m (308ft) above sea level.
